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 82862312 869628866 7552
531 5059129197
531 5059129197
8054022 0176954 53330422
All about undefined
Interested in learning more?
531 5059129197
8054022 0176954 53330422
See more
3165961339 010933 94865602
7645 044281601 17083
See more
48491402271 8715
01 090047005 751
See more